About the Team

The Sensors Division at STR focuses on technology development for advanced sensor systems to add national security capabilities, particularly in the areas of airborne/surface-based radar, electronic warfare, underwater acoustics, hyperspectral imaging, and EO/IR sensing. Within these areas, we perform work on emerging concepts & technologies, component & system development and prototyping, and experimental campaigns.

The Optical & Novel Sensing (ONS) Group within the Sensors Division pursues physics-driven research across multiple domains to provide warfighter and intelligence mission performance unachievable with traditional sensors. Our main customer focus is on Department of War and Intelligence Community research and development programs, with work spanning concept formulation through validation prototyping.
